Abstract
The utility model discloses a kind of sewage disposal filter, including water inlet, sand removal room, suction cutter, shower nozzle and ozone equipment, the both sides of the water inlet are provided with manhole cover plate, and sundry filter net is fixed with below, motor is installed on the outside of the sand removal room, the suction cutter is connected with each other by rotating vane and rotary shaft, the shower nozzle is located at the lower section of sponge filter, and it is connected with each other by sprinkling irrigation and backwashing pump, the backwashing pump is connected with each other by backwash tube and disinfection room, and disinfection room is connected with each other by the second barricade and filter chamber, and bactericidal lamp is installed inside it, the ozone equipment is located at the bottom of disinfection room, and delivery port is connected with the right side of disinfection room.The sewage disposal filter, debris can be filtered and is collected, the gravel in sewage is effectively removed using sand removal room, effectively the fine particle in absorption effluent, circulation flushing, substantially increase the efficiency of filtering, the effect of sterilization is good.

Operation principle:When using the sewage disposal filter, first the structure of the device is simply understood,
Sewage is entered in sand removal room 4 from water inlet 1 first, is tentatively filtered by sundry filter net 3, by the filtering foreign in sewage
Get off, debris can be collected by manhole cover plate 2, prevent debris from accumulating the phenomenon that results in blockage, and motor 41 passes through biography
Motivation structure 42 drives the rotation of rotary shaft 43, and is rotated together with the rotating vane 44 of the lower end of rotary shaft 43, gravel rotation from
In the presence of the heart and sedimentation, separated with sewage and be drawn into by suction cutter 45 in sand collecting hopper 5, opening Sand pump 6 can be carried out
The removing of gravel, the sewage after desanding is entered in filter chamber 8 by the first barricade 7, by sponge filter 9 to thin in sewage
Little particle is filtered and adsorbed, and the sewage after filtering is entered in disinfection room 13 by the second barricade 12, by the He of sterilamp 16
Ozone equipment 17 carries out dual sterilization, and the effect of sterilization is good, at the same sterilize after water in the presence of backwashing pump 14 by anti-
Flush pipe 15 is entered in jet pipe 11, is flowed into by shower nozzle 10 in filter chamber 8, not only strengthens the mobility of sewage, and repeatedly
Filtering, overall filter efficiency is high, and most reprocessed sewage is discharged from delivery port 18, and here it is the sewage disposal is used
Filter the operation principle of device.
